With each fresh look it's getting more mysterious ... In

https://build.opensuse.org/public/build/home:dancermak:branches:devel:libraries:c_c++/openSUSE_Factory/x86_64/notmuch/_log

I see that tests are run with gnu parallel and not sequentially. The only
FAILs are the sig_uid ones in T356.

So, apparantly, the local buildah run does something different from OBS.
